Radiology logo #21000 Radiology is a medical specialty that employs the use of imaging to both diagnose and treat disease visualized within the body. Radiologists use an array of imaging technologies such as X-ray radiography, ultrasound, computed tomography (CT), nuclear medicine, positron emission tomography (PET) and mag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) to diagnose or t...

Radiology logo #20909Radiology: The branch of medicine that uses ionizing and nonionizing radiation for the diagnosis and treatment of disease. Historically, radiology involved the use of ionizing radiation including X rays for the diagnosis of disease and X rays and gamma rays for the treatment of disease.
